Warm Peanut Ginger Agave or Maple Sauce
This waffle topping recipe blends sweetness with two types of gentle warmth: temperature and a bit of spice. If you live somewhere with cold winters as we do, this can be especially welcome!
Ingredients
- 1/2 cup peanut butter may be smooth or crunchy
- 1/2 cup agave nectar or real maple syrup
- 1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
Instructions
- Place all ingredients in a small saucepan and warm over low heat, stirring constantly. Continue 1 to 3 minutes, or until peanut butter is melted and mixture is well-blended and thoroughly heated. Spoon over your favorite vegan waffle, and do a little dance around the table.
- To add even more flavor and texture, top with sliced fresh banana or thinly-sliced fresh apple.
Notes
Variation: Add 1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on.
